- Joined
- Oct 15, 2013
- Messages
- 515
- Reaction score
- 159
Hello all, @Zychronix aka deathstar and I, are back to help you guys out with your Wz editing needs.
We decided to actually release a 3-in-1 bundle thing so to speak. This includes our WzClear and our XML Source Parser that was released before, but it has been recoded and works more efficiently. The third thing we are adding is a Character Node Finder. The name is self explanatory. It finds nodes inside the Character.wz.
The correct order for importing CHARACTER files are as followed;
Source Parser > Node Finder > Wz Clear
Do NOT change the order or it will mess up.
The idea is to run the CMDs which is quicker then doing it through NetBeans. However do note that doing all three steps will take about a day or so, depending on your hard drive.
Each XML you wish to edit, has to be in the CLASSIC format.
Export as Classic > Run program > Reimport into the WZ.
Lets get into what is being released right here;
XML Source Parser
This is what most of you guys will be downloading this file for. This makes those pesky blinking items not blink no more. This it goes to the source and copies the canvas data. In case you do not know, the WzUOL property is inside every Maplestory version and acts just the same as the Source property.
You can type it in without a WZ folder and it will do the entire wz directory.
You need one main folder, it will run if you are missing folders (meaning when you export the folders of the kinds of items that are there) but if it tries to get a source value from a different wz file or a different file that doesn't exist it'll give you errors.
Here is our older XML Parser.
Character Node Finder
This needs to be ran before you do any of the other two projects. They find the nodes that is coded inside the Character.wz
How does this help? You ask, well it finds the nodes in all the items so that way if it is a node that Nexon just added, it will be in the list and that way you can use the WzClear to get rid of the pesky little node that is not coded inside the version of Maplestory you are working on. That simple!
Be sure to change your file location.
WzClear
WzClear is a nice little thing. It gets rid of those pesky little nodes that isn't coded into your Maplestory version. Now for you to know exactly what is and isnt coded. All you really need to do is get a clean Character.wz file and run the Node finder and see what nodes are inside your version. Then run the Node Finder again on the newest GMS/KMS or whatever files to know whats there and boom, use WzClear to remove all the nodes that you don't need and now you got working items.
One main thing you must do before running WzClear is changing the file location. Open up the file in NetBeans or whatever it is you use, and change the location.
This is what you need to change.
If you keep scrolling you will see this line of code;
This is what WzClear will NOT remove. If there is anything on this list that you want to keep, put it on the list otherwise WzClear will automatically remove it. If you want things to removed, then just delete it from the list.
Here is a link to our old WzClear release, the way to run it is mostly the same.
I'm not exactly sure what else to write, I'm just gonna end it here. If you need reference the older versions of these items are posted in this thread. I will adding a virus scan to the .rar file as well. If you need any help with anything just post below.
We decided to actually release a 3-in-1 bundle thing so to speak. This includes our WzClear and our XML Source Parser that was released before, but it has been recoded and works more efficiently. The third thing we are adding is a Character Node Finder. The name is self explanatory. It finds nodes inside the Character.wz.
The correct order for importing CHARACTER files are as followed;
Source Parser > Node Finder > Wz Clear
Do NOT change the order or it will mess up.
The idea is to run the CMDs which is quicker then doing it through NetBeans. However do note that doing all three steps will take about a day or so, depending on your hard drive.
Each XML you wish to edit, has to be in the CLASSIC format.
Export as Classic > Run program > Reimport into the WZ.
Lets get into what is being released right here;
XML Source Parser
This is what most of you guys will be downloading this file for. This makes those pesky blinking items not blink no more. This it goes to the source and copies the canvas data. In case you do not know, the WzUOL property is inside every Maplestory version and acts just the same as the Source property.
PHP:
java -cp dist/XML.jar UltimateXMLSourceParser W:\\Parse Character.wz
pause
You can type it in without a WZ folder and it will do the entire wz directory.
You need one main folder, it will run if you are missing folders (meaning when you export the folders of the kinds of items that are there) but if it tries to get a source value from a different wz file or a different file that doesn't exist it'll give you errors.
Here is our older XML Parser.
Character Node Finder
This needs to be ran before you do any of the other two projects. They find the nodes that is coded inside the Character.wz
How does this help? You ask, well it finds the nodes in all the items so that way if it is a node that Nexon just added, it will be in the list and that way you can use the WzClear to get rid of the pesky little node that is not coded inside the version of Maplestory you are working on. That simple!
Be sure to change your file location.
PHP:
static String BASE_FOLDER = "F:\\MapleStory";
WzClear
WzClear is a nice little thing. It gets rid of those pesky little nodes that isn't coded into your Maplestory version. Now for you to know exactly what is and isnt coded. All you really need to do is get a clean Character.wz file and run the Node finder and see what nodes are inside your version. Then run the Node Finder again on the newest GMS/KMS or whatever files to know whats there and boom, use WzClear to remove all the nodes that you don't need and now you got working items.
One main thing you must do before running WzClear is changing the file location. Open up the file in NetBeans or whatever it is you use, and change the location.
PHP:
static String BASE_FOLDER = "F:\\MapleStory\\v90\\Character.wz";
This is what you need to change.
If you keep scrolling you will see this line of code;
PHP:
static String[] knownNodes = {
This is what WzClear will NOT remove. If there is anything on this list that you want to keep, put it on the list otherwise WzClear will automatically remove it. If you want things to removed, then just delete it from the list.
Here is a link to our old WzClear release, the way to run it is mostly the same.
I'm not exactly sure what else to write, I'm just gonna end it here. If you need reference the older versions of these items are posted in this thread. I will adding a virus scan to the .rar file as well. If you need any help with anything just post below.
You must be registered to see links
You must be registered to see links
Last edited: